Simulating experimental areas

• My main tool: FLUKA

• It was the best of times, it was the worst of times

• Shoot a particle into a thing, easy!

• But simulating a particle alone is never enough

• What secondary beam do you have after the target?

• How can you dump the beam?

• How much radiation is produced and where does it go?

• How much interaction is there with air / vacuum windows / remaining gas?

• Where can I stand when the experiment is running?

• Where can I stand when the experiment is not running?

• How much background do we get from neutrons / muons / …..?

• Why does RP not want me to make a target out of tungsten?

• Do I really have to wear a helmet in the experimental areas?

Neutral beamline for KLEVER

• Neutral version of NA62

• Measure KLπ0 νν

• Fully neutral! Makes life difficult….

• Found many interesting things

• XCLD collimator too small

• Need 2xTCX extra to kill background

So many magnets…..

• Magnets form the heart of our simulations

• Require special routines to read and use magnetic field maps

• High-quality field maps are extremely important!!

• Many OPERA simulations performed by Philip Schwarz (TE-MSC-MNC)

• Without this work, none of my simulations would have worked (yes, really!)

• Measurements important but not enough: need field in yoke!

Putting field maps to work

• Real goal of using accurate field maps: track muons through magnet yokes, and see where they end up

• Enough muons to completely overload KLEVER detectors, so they need to go somewhere else

M. Van Dijk 27.11.2019 PBC meeting overview 9

• …but not NA62 control room

• And also not cause too much radiation outside of ECN3
